For audiophiles, “extra quality” means no resampling, no gain normalization, and no extra DSP. The codec should output the exact decoded PCM samples to the audio sink, preserving dynamic range.

Some E‑AC‑3 streams contain Dolby Atmos objects. A basic decoder ignores this, while an “extra quality” custom codec might pass through the Atmos metadata to an HDMI or Bluetooth device that supports it, though MX Player itself does not render object‑based audio natively.
